A recent study conducted by French teams (INSERM, APHP-CUP, Institut Pasteur) focused on immune responses in 50 COVID19 patients with different disease severity. They found that patients with severe forms of the disease showed low to no interferon (IFN) type I response, persistent viral load and an excessive inflammatory response. Based on these findings, type I IFN deficiency may be a hallmark of severe COVID19 and therapeutic approaches could be adapted.
